**14:22** — Marisol confirmed that the Ledgerfox spreadsheet export worker was buffering entire workbooks in memory rather than streaming rows, pushing resident usage past 6 GB on large tenants. The pod was OOM-killed twice before the alert fired. Mitigation: row-streaming flag enabled on the export pool; permanent fix tracked for next sprint. The affected deployment can be identified by the trace token below.

trace token, kawip-fafog: htk14_26e64c4d35154e

Approvals for Customer Deduplication — Marrowgate Platform. All merge batches in the DupeSieve tool require a two-step approval: the proposer runs a dry match, then an approver reviews the collision report. New team members cannot approve their own batches. Questions about approval scope should be directed to the person named below.

account owner for bawip-tahag: Raleth Quenok

# Bounce processor constants (Mailrook core).
#
# Plugin authors: do not override these at runtime. Hard bounces are
# classified once and suppressed permanently; soft bounces retry on the
# backoff schedule below. Exceeding the soft-retry ceiling converts the
# address to a hard bounce. Your plugin hooks fire after classification,
# never before. Batch sizes are tuned for the Kelver queue backend and
# changing them will desync the suppression ledger. Everything you may
# need to reference is defined here:

tuning table, yajog-yahof:
BUDGETS = {
    "lamvan": 303,
    "wenox": 460,
    "fenvan": 525,
}

## Formula sandbox tuning

User-supplied formulas in Gridmoor execute inside a restricted interpreter with hard ceilings on time, memory, and call depth. Reviewers should confirm any change to these ceilings is justified in the PR description, since raising them widens the abuse surface. Defaults were chosen from production traces. The current limits are as follows.

limits module of tafog-fawip:
WEIGHTS = {
    "julix": 57,
    "lamys": 992,
    "kasvan": 209,
    "quenok": 750,
    "alddor": 259,
    "oliath": 1009,
    "wenix": 815,
}